Pedalshift moves bikes between dock clusters overnight. It runs under the `svc-pedalshift` account. Do not run rebalancing jobs under personal accounts; audit logs must show the service identity.

The account has read access to dock telemetry and write access to the dispatch queue only. Rotation happens quarterly, handled by the infra rotation bot. If a job fails with an auth error mid-quarter, check the clock skew first.

For local testing against the staging dispatch API, authenticate with the key below.

API key for yahig-tadup: kto7_ubizbYm

Handover — dedup project, from Casper to Ilya (cc support). Quick brain dump before I'm out: the Tanglerun dedup job merges customer records nightly, matching on normalized name plus postal fragment. Support folks, if a customer says their account "merged wrong," don't un-merge by hand — use the split tool in the Burrow console, it preserves order history. The fuzzy-match threshold is at 0.87; lower it and chaos follows. To open the Burrow console's admin split tool, enter the passphrase below.

unlock words, fadug-tageg: zorix-wenwyn-quenmir

Ticket: CAT-2291 — Stale prices lingering after catalog publish

Hey, flagging this before the Thursday cut. The Pricewheel cache isn't invalidating when merchandisers republish a product in Stockaroo.

Repro:
1. Edit any SKU price in the Stockaroo admin.
2. Publish the catalog.
3. Hit the storefront product page within 5 minutes — old price still shows.
4. Purge manually via the cache API and it updates fine.

Smells like the publish webhook isn't firing the purge. To repro the manual purge call, use the bearer token below.

bearer token for yahog-tawip: eyJhbGciOiJIUzI1NiIsInR5cCI6IkpXVCJ9.eyJzdWIiOiI7GwpwSyDv4In0.pfTDYU1AuskL

Partners on the Quillhaven program deliver weekly manifests via our SFTP drop, which lands files in the intake bucket polled by the Ferrowisp ingest service every ten minutes. The release manager is responsible for confirming the drop is healthy before each cut. To query Ferrowisp's intake status endpoint during release verification, authenticate with the internal API key provided below.

app token of bahaf-tajeg = zpat23_SjjsllwiLmXbtS65veZaV47